Roll-A-Ball-With-Audio

Roll-A-Ball, now with sound! For USC course CTIN 406L: Sound Design for Games.

Based on Unity's Roll-A-Ball tutorial, adapting the completed project files and adding newly implemented audio.

Week 4 Assignment: Audio Replacement

  1. Download the week4-implementation version of the project and open Assets/Scenes/RollABallWithAudio.unity
  2. Replace all existing audio with new sound assets that you create
  3. (Optional) Implement new audio where there previously was none
    • Some ideas:
      • VO for each pickup that matches the current pickup count
      • A third sound zone with new looping ambience
      • Fading out the music once the player wins
  4. Create a Windows build, zip it, and upload the zip using the form provided in class
  5. Come to class prepared to share and discuss with everyone!
